U.S. WOOL CONSUMPTION.

Received August 2, 1.15 a.m. WASHINGTON, July 31. The Department of Agriculture announced that the June consumption of w’ool is 46 million pounds, which is seventeen millions below the average monthly consumption in 1 920. This was due to the curtailment of textile manufacturing.
